Skills

Successful candidates will need to:

  • Hold a BEd or Bachelor's degree in Drama with PGCE / PGDE or equivalent  

  • Lead, mentor, and support a team of Drama teachers to ensure high-quality teaching and learning.

  • Have a willingness to collaborate and share their outstanding practice  

  • Have a growth mindset, whereby they are reflective, and solution focused  

  • Be creative and enthusiastic in their approach to teaching  

  • Possess excellent interpersonal skills to work closely with colleagues, students and parents  

  • Have a proven track record of providing outstanding learning & teaching  

  • Have aspiration to work in a world-class school with real prospects for enhancing their career  

  • Be willing to make a positive contribution to our school community and culture through active engagement in our extra-curricular programme and community-based events.  

Core Responsibilities

  • Deliver high-quality, engaging lessons aligned to the required curriculum.
  • Create a supportive and inclusive classroom environment for diverse learners.
  • Assess student progress rigorously and provide timely, constructive feedback.
  • Participate actively in broader school life, including extra-curricular programs.
  • Collaborate with departmental colleagues to elevate instructional strategies.

Candidate Requirements

  • A recognized teaching qualification (e.g., PGCE, QTS, or equivalent).
  • A minimum of 2 years verifiable post-qualification teaching experience.
  • Demonstrable track record of excellent student outcomes.
  • A bachelor's degree directly related to your teaching specialization.
  • Clear criminal record check spanning the last 10 years of residency.
